Title :
A new excitation regulating and harmonic eliminating equipment for fixed speed fixed pitch wind turbines

Abstract :
The fixed pitch fixed speed wind turbines are used in China commonly. The main problem of this type of wind turbine system is the low availability of wind energy. A solution is to change it to variable speed wind turbine system and to interconnect it to power grid through rectifying circuit and inverter unit. In this work, a new-style equipment is also designed which can regulate the excitation current and eliminate the harmonic current. It can control coordinately with the rectifier and inverter. In this proposed system, the rotating speed of the generator is variable, and the availability of both wind energy and generator is improved. And the excitation regulating equipment can also eliminate the harmonic current caused by the rectifier and inverter, which can step down the detriment to the torque of the generator and improve the performance-cost ratio of the whole system.
